List of Wildlife refuges in Australia

There are 116 Wildlife refuges in Australia as of January 23, 2025; which is an 3.48% increase from 2023. Of these locations, 105 Wildlife refuges which is 90.52% of all Wildlife refuges in Australia are single-owner operations, while the remaining 11 which is 9.48% are part of larger brands. The top three states with the most Wildlife refuges are New South Wales with 37 Wildlife refuges, Victoria with 24 Wildlife refuges, Queensland with 23 Wildlife refuges. Average age of Wildlife refuges in Australia is 7 years and 8 months.
